What is an equation of the line that passes through the point (8,2) and is parallel to the line x+4y=28

Answers

Answer:

y = -1/4x + 4

Step-by-step explanation:

x+4y=28

4y = -x + 28

y = -1/4x + 7

slope m = -1/4

Parallel lines have similar slope so we'll use -1/4 from above and given point (8,2) to find y-intercept.

y = mx +b

2 = -1/4(8) + b

2 = -2 + b

b = 4

Using m and b from above we can now form the new equation of line that is parallel to y = -1/4x + 7.

y = mx + b

y = -1/4x + 4

Pizza is sold at a restaurant in 3 sizes: small (S), medium (M), and large (L). Customers can choose from 4 toppings to be used on a 1-topping pizza. The 4 toppings are green peppers (G), ham (H), pepperoni (P), and olives (O).

A customer plans to order a large or medium 1-topping pizza with any topping except pepperoni (P).

This sample space shows all the types of 1-topping pizzas. Which outcomes in this sample space show the types of pizza the customer may order?

Select all correct outcomes

Pizza is sold at a restaurant in 3 sizes: small (S), medium (M), and large (L). Customers can choose

Answers

Using the given sample space, it is found that the types of pizza the customer may order is: {MG, MH, MO, LG, LH, LO}

The sample space is the set that contains all possible outcomes.

In this problem:

The pizza is large or medium, hence the first letter has to be M or L.The topping is any except pepperoni, hence, the second letter is G, H or O.

Thus, the possible outcomes are: {MG, MH, MO, LG, LH, LO}

Find the centroid of the region in the first quadrant bounded by the given curves. y = x4, x = y4

Answers

The given bounded region is the set

\(R = \left\{(x,y) ~:~ 0 \le x \le 1 \text{ and } x^4 \le y \le x^{1/4} \right\}\)

assuming the curves are \(y=x^4\) and \(x=y^4\implies y=x^{1/4}\) (since \(x>0\) in the first quadrant).

The coordinates of the centroid are \((\bar x, \bar y)\) where \(\bar x\) and \(\bar y\) are the average values of \(x\) and \(y\), respectively, over the region \(R\). These are given by the ratios

\(\bar x = \dfrac{\displaystyle \iint_R x \, dA}{\displaystyle \iint_R dA} \text{ and } \bar y = \dfrac{\displaystyle \iint_R y\,dA}{\displaystyle \iint_R dA}\)

Compute the area of \(R\).

\(\displaystyle \iint_R dA = \int_0^1 \int_{x^4}^{x^{1/4}} dy \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\int_0^1 \left(x^{1/4} - x^4\right) \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\frac45 - \frac15 = \frac35\)

Integrate \(x\) and \(y\) over \(R\).

\(\displaystyle \iint_R x \, dA = \int_0^1 \int_{x^4}^{x^{1/4}} x \, dy \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\int_0^1 x \left(x^{1/4} - x^4\right) \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\int_0^1 \left(x^{5/4} - x^5\right) \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\frac49 - \frac16 = \frac5{18}\)

\(\displaystyle \iint_R y \, dA = \int_0^1 \int_{x^4}^{x^{1/4}} y \, dy \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\frac12 \int_0^1 \left((x^{1/4})^2 - (x^4)^2\right) \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\frac12 \int_0^1 \left(x^{1/2} - x^8\right) \, dx \\\\ ~~~~~~~~ = \frac12 \left(\frac23 - \frac19\right) = \frac5{18}\)

Then the centroid's coordinates are

\(\bar x = \dfrac{\frac5{18}}{\frac35} = \boxed{\frac{25}{54}} \approx 0.463\)

\(\bar y = \dfrac{\frac5{18}}{\frac35} = \boxed{\frac{25}{54}}\)

14 Jun 2018 · Norman is 12 years older than Michael. In 6 years, he will be twice as old as Michael. How old is Michael now? (A) 3 (B) 6 (C) 12

Answers

Michael is now (B) 6 years old.

Let's start by defining variables for the current ages of Norman and Michael.

Let N be Norman's current age, and M be Michael's current age.

From the problem statement, we know that N = M + 12 (Norman is 12 years older than Michael).

We also know that in 6 years, Norman will be twice as old as Michael.

So we can set up the following equation:

N + 6 = 2(M + 6)

Substituting N = M + 12 into the equation, we get:

M + 12 + 6 = 2(M + 6)

Simplifying:

M + 18 = 2M + 12

M = 6

Therefore, Michael is currently 6 years old.

Answer: (B) 6
